Popcorn Chicken
1 lb pound chicken
pancake mix
favorite seasoning (all season, alpine, or what you like to season with)
* Cut up the chicken in bite size's pieces (ie 1" x 1", or bigger)
* Season them
* Dip them in the pancake mix
* Place them in hot oil (canola or EVOO, I used EVOO). You can use a fry daddy. I used a large skillet with long edges. Make sure the chicken is completly covered in oil
* Fry in oil till brown
* Dip in ranch or try coctail sauce
It tastes like mini fried chicken w/ the bone.
Beer Can Chicken
ReplyDeleteThaw and clean a whole chicken, rinse. Apply a poultry rub or other desired seasoning.
Use 12oz can beer or soda. Pour out half of contents. You may add seasoning to beer such as worchestire sauce, liquid smoke, garlic, etc.
Place chicken upright over beer can, stuff a small potato or onion in neck and place on grill. Place in a pie pan and add 1/4 cup of water. For oven : Place in a pie pan and add 1/4 cup of water. Cook at 350 degees.
Cook 1-2 hours or until skin is dark golden brown and crisp. Using a meat thermometer, temperature should reach 180 degrees.
When done transfer in an upright position to a platter. Let stand 5 to 10 minutes.

ReplyDeleteOlive Oil Rubbed Chicken
1 lb Chicken legs (and or mix with leg quarters)
Olive Oil
Chili Powder
Garlic Salt
Place chicken in a bowl with Olive Oil.
Rub the oil into the chicken.
Place chicken on a large platter (if legs quarters, upside down.
Sprinkle chili powder and garlic salt & then rub in also. Flip the chicken and sprinkle with chili powder and garlic salt & rub again.
BBQ 10-13 min on a side
Chicken Fried Chicken
ReplyDelete1 lb chicken breasts
flour
egg
milk
season all
olive oil
butter
* Take a frying pan, place 1 tbs butter, drizzle some evoo in the bottem & heat on stove
* Take a cereal bowl and crack one egg & fill the rest of the bowl with milk (leave an inch or two) Mix the egg & milk with a fork or wire whisk
* Take the chickn breasts & cut them in half (the width side), so they arn't so thick. It doesn't take so long to cook
* Take 1 cup of flour & place on a plate or paper plate
* Dip each chicken breast in the flour, the the egg mix, and back into the flour
* Season one side the chicken breast with Season All & place that side down in the frying pan. Then season the other side
* Fry 6-12 min & then flip. They should start to turn a golden brown. Feel free to flip each side another time for a couple of more min each, for a more golden brown & it also leaves more stock in the pan for gravey
